/**
+ * Type of a credential hook error/event.
+ */
+enum credential_hook_type_t {
+ /** The certificate has expired (or is not yet valid) */
+ CRED_HOOK_EXPIRED,
+ /** The certificate has been revoked */
+ CRED_HOOK_REVOKED,
+ /** Checking certificate revocation failed. This does not necessarily mean
+ * the certificate is rejected, just that revocation checking failed. */
+ CRED_HOOK_VALIDATION_FAILED,
+ /** No trusted issuer certificate has been found for this certificate */
+ CRED_HOOK_NO_ISSUER,
+ /** Encountered a self-signed (root) certificate, but it is not trusted */
+ CRED_HOOK_UNTRUSTED_ROOT,
+ /** Maximum trust chain length exceeded for certificate */
+ CRED_HOOK_EXCEEDED_PATH_LEN,
+ /** The certificate violates some other kind of policy and gets rejected */
+ CRED_HOOK_POLICY_VIOLATION,
+};
+
+/**
+ * Hook function to invoke on certificate validation errors.
+ *
+ * @param data user data supplied during hook registration
+ * @param type type of validation error/event
+ * @param cert associated certificate
+ */
+typedef void (*credential_hook_t)(void *data, credential_hook_type_t type,
+ certificate_t *cert);
+

/**
+ * Set a hook to call on certain credential validation errors.
+ *
+ * @param hook hook to register, NULL to unregister
+ * @param data data to pass to hook
+ */
+ void (*set_hook)(credential_manager_t *this, credential_hook_t hook,
+ void *data);
+
+ /**
+ * Call the registered credential hook, if any.
+ *
+ * While hooks are usually called by the credential manager itself, some
+ * validator plugins might raise hooks as well if they consider certificates
+ * invalid.
+ *
+ * @param type type of the event
+ * @param cert associated certificate
+ */
+ void (*call_hook)(credential_manager_t *this, credential_hook_type_t type,
+ certificate_t *cert);
+
